PySide: differenze tra le versioni

Contenuto cancellato Contenuto aggiunto
m aggiornata versione ed aggiunto esempio "hello world"
m Esempio di Hello world: Aggiunto i numeri di riga nel blocco di codice
 
(30 versioni intermedie di 21 utenti non mostrate)
Riga 1:
{{Aggiornare|arg=informatica}}
{{Infobox_Software |
 
nome = PySide|
{{Software
screenshot = |
nome|Nome = PySide|
didascalia = |
|Logo =
sviluppatore = [[Nokia]] |
|Screenshot =
versione_ultimo_rilascio = 1.0.0 |
|Didascalia =
data_ultimo_rilascio = [[4 marzo]], [[2011]] |
sviluppatore|Sviluppatore = [[Nokia]] |
sistema_operativo = [[Multipiattaforma]] |
|UltimaVersione = 6.4.0.1
genere = Libreria di sviluppo |
|DataUltimaVersione = 27 Ottobre [[2022]]
linguaggio = [[Python]] |
|UltimaVersioneBeta =
licenza = [http://www.pyside.org/about/ Licenza LGPL] |
|DataUltimaVersioneBeta =
sito_web = [http://www.pyside.org www.pyside.org] |
|SistemaOperativo = multipiattaforma
|Genere = Libreria software
licenza|Licenza = [http://www.pyside.org/about/ Licenza LGPL] |
|SoftwareLibero = sì
|Lingua =
}}
 
'''PySide''' è un [[binding]] delle [[Qt (toolkit)|Qt]] per [[Python]].
 
delle [[Qt_(toolkit)|Qt]] per [[Python]].
Nell'Agosto 2009, [[Nokia]], che ha acquisito la proprietà delle librerie Qt (grazie all'acquisizione della [[Trolltech]]<ref>{{cita web|url=http://www.hwupgrade.it/news/telefonia/nokia-acquisisce-trolltech_24033.html|titolo=Nokia acquisisce Trolltech|data=29-1-2008|accesso=21-9-2010|editore=Hardware Upgrade}}</ref>
), ha rilasciatopubblicato PySide, fornendo funzionalità simili a PyQt, ma sotto licenza [[LGPL]], dopo aver cercato di raggiungere un accordo con la società Riverbank Computing, creatrice delle PyQt, al fine di convincerla a fornire come ulteriore licenza quella LGPL. Le librerie PyQt sono infatti disponibili sotto doppia Licenza: [[GNU_General_Public_LicenseGNU General Public License|GPL]] e Commerciale.
Lo sviluppo è curato da OpenBossa INdT in Brasile ed è finanziato da Nokia stessa. Il finanziamento al progetto scadrà a fine 2011.
 
PySide attualmente supporta:
* [[Linux]]/[[X Window System|X11]]
* [[Mac OS XmacOS]]
* [[Maemo]] 5
* [[MeeGo]]
* [[Windows]]
 
==Esempio di Hello world==
 
<sourcesyntaxhighlight lang="python" line="1">
import sys
from PySide import QtCore, QtGui
Riga 36 ⟶ 43:
win.resize(320, 240)
win.setWindowTitle("Hello, World!")
win.show()
 
sys.exit(app.exec_())
</syntaxhighlight>
</source>
 
== Note ==
Riga 45 ⟶ 52:
 
== Voci correlate ==
* [[Qt (toolkit)|Qt]]
* [[Python]]
* [[wxPython]]
* [[PyGTK]]
 
 
== Collegamenti esterni ==
* {{Collegamenti esterni}}
*[http://www.pyside.org Sito ufficiale di PySide]
* {{cita web | 1 = http://qt.nokia.com | 2 = Sito ufficiale di Qt | accesso = 2 maggio 2019 | urlarchivio = https://web.archive.org/web/20121226190411/http://qt.nokia.com/ | dataarchivio = 26 dicembre 2012 | urlmorto = sì }}
*[http://qt.nokia.com Sito ufficiale di Qt]
 
{{Portale|informatica}}
 
[[Categoria:Interfacce graficheQt]]
[[Categoria:Librerie Python]]